Output 3d9664f153ab58e5a1384ad1ef68d784082637315b354ce68e03e75979858778:1

value
245598406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 265ee57ddd58e5590bd323c528577c66a94ef869 OP_EQUAL
address
35BuHMWMyWAYsfZfcqkkFjXkoyyVWHaggR
transaction
3d9664f153ab58e5a1384ad1ef68d784082637315b354ce68e03e75979858778
spent
true